THE TURBULENT HISTORY OF THE IONIAN ISLANDS
Presented by
EFFIE DETSIMAS
Effie will give us facts based on Lord Michael Pratt’s book, published 1978,
“Britain’s Greek Empire”, from the Venetian rule and ending with the British
rule, plus stories from the island people now living in Australia.

Announcement of Scholarship
The Peter Spathis Foundation has announced the establishment of the Peter Spathis
Foundation Scholarship. The inaugural Scholarship will be granted for full time tertiary
study commencing in 2012 and is open to all year 12 students of Greek descent who
propose to undertake any recognised University Course in 2012. Scholarship Application
form is available at www.peterspathisfoundation.com.au and for more information contact
